I recently joined MUD and I'm addicted to it already. I have zero experience with FJs and been reading/learning daily. I currently own a 2002 Toyota Tacoma DC, 2015 Tundra Crew Max TRD Off-Road 4x4 and a 1971 K5 Blazer 4x4. My K5 is currently for sale so I may fund my FJ purchase. I love the K5, but my family and I need a more kid friendly vehicle with a more creature comforts. The FJ 60 series totally fits the bill. A very capable 4x4 family wagon that still has the vintage classic vibe to it.
The search began in the usual places like eBay, Craigslist and Autotrader. I'm looking for something with under 200K miles and in the 10K-15K price range. I found two Fj62s that have potential. One is in the Dallas area about 5 hours from my home and another is in PA. I have purchased vehicles in the past from out of state and had them shipped, so the one in PA doesn't scare me off. I'm worried about PA winters and the havoc salted roads can cause to these vehicles. I requested the Autocheck report for the FJ62 (1988) in PA and it spent its first 11 years in Montana. After that it spent the next 5 years in Norwalk, Connecticut and the next 10 years in Mount Laurel, NJ. Do the winters in the states I mention wreak havoc on FJs like in PA? I'm from South Texas where we have two seasons, one month of mild winter and summer. We have zero snow and the city I live shuts down if a thin sheet of ice or sleet falls on the roads. The FJ from PA only has 189K miles on the odometer. Can anybody recommend a third party inspection company, so I can have the vehicle inspected before I make an offer?
